Bill Summary

For legislation to direct the Department of Environmental Protection to publish a toxic chemicals of concern consumer products list. Consumer Protection and Professional Licensure.

AI Summary

This bill directs the Massachusetts Department of Environmental Protection (DEP) to create and maintain comprehensive lists of toxic chemicals in children's products, with the primary goal of protecting children's health. The bill defines "children's products" broadly, including toys, clothing, school supplies, and other items designed for or marketed to children 12 years old and under. Specifically, the bill requires the DEP to publish a list of "toxic chemicals of concern" that includes carcinogens, endocrine disruptors, reproductive toxicants, and other hazardous substances, consulting multiple authoritative bodies like the EPA and International Agency for Research on Cancer. Manufacturers of children's products must notify the DEP if their products contain these chemicals above a minimal threshold, and for certain high-risk products (like those designed for children under 3 or those that can be placed in the mouth), manufacturers must eventually remove or substitute these chemicals. The bill also mandates that the DEP create a list of high-priority chemicals and potentially safer alternative chemicals, and requires manufacturers to conduct hazard assessments when substituting chemicals. Manufacturers can face civil penalties up to $5,000 for first offenses and $10,000 for repeat violations, and must recall products that violate the regulations. The DEP must submit a comprehensive report every three years detailing progress, challenges, and recommendations for addressing toxic chemicals in children's products.
